.tips-module-f5838c071573fd2182dc5cf16b336ede{background-color:#fff;padding:.533333rem;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;border-radius:.266667rem;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center}.tips-module-f5838c071573fd2182dc5cf16b336ede .title{text-align:center;font-size:.48rem;margin-bottom:.533333rem}.tips-module-f5838c071573fd2182dc5cf16b336ede .qr-code{width:50%;border:.026667rem solid hsla(0,0%,40%,.5);border-radius:.133333rem;padding:.266667rem}.tips-module-f5838c071573fd2182dc5cf16b336ede .qr-code img{width:100%}.tips-module-f5838c071573fd2182dc5cf16b336ede .submit-button{margin-top:.533333rem;padding:.4rem 0;background:-webkit-gradient(linear,left top,left bottom,from(#66a6ff),to(#7266ff));background:-webkit-linear-gradient(top,#66a6ff,#7266ff);background:linear-gradient(180deg,#66a6ff,#7266ff)}.select-reservation-type-page-dfb60fd6c726ebd612cdd68aec7fe7d9{height:100vh;position:relative;overflow-y:auto}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56,.select-reservation-type-page-dfb60fd6c726ebd612cdd68aec7fe7d9{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56{position:absolute;z-index:2;top:8rem;width:100%;height:92vh}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56 .tips-f8dcd6d802c46972de4966871a22f9ff{padding:.266667rem;background-color:#eef8fe;border-radius:.266667rem .266667rem 0 0;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;justify-content:space-between}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56 .content-message-c2ecb54d47d2482721d5173f8d0ef474{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1;background-color:#fff;padding:.533333rem}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56 .content-message-c2ecb54d47d2482721d5173f8d0ef474 .title-9c3ceda6ac39f73492c097fe62a246a6{color:#66affc;font-size:.533333rem;font-weight:600;line-height:.8rem;margin-bottom:.266667rem}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56 .content-message-c2ecb54d47d2482721d5173f8d0ef474 .info-item{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-align:baseline;-webkit-align-items:baseline;-ms-flex-align:baseline;align-items:baseline;margin-bottom:.1rem;line-height:.46rem}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56 .content-message-c2ecb54d47d2482721d5173f8d0ef474 .info-item img{width:.3rem;height:.3rem;margin-right:.1rem}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56 .content-message-c2ecb54d47d2482721d5173f8d0ef474 .reservationType-988f9da053526ce16e9af077e255896b{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;margin-top:.4rem}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56 .content-message-c2ecb54d47d2482721d5173f8d0ef474 .reservationType-988f9da053526ce16e9af077e255896b .individual-type{border-radius:.133333rem;width:60%;height:4.8rem;background:-webkit-gradient(linear,left top,left bottom,from(#66a6ff),to(#7266ff));background:-webkit-linear-gradient(top,#66a6ff,#7266ff);background:linear-gradient(180deg,#66a6ff,#7266ff);position:relative}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56 .content-message-c2ecb54d47d2482721d5173f8d0ef474 .reservationType-988f9da053526ce16e9af077e255896b .individual-type .iconfont{font-size:2.666667rem;color:#fff;opacity:.5;position:absolute;bottom:0;right:0}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56 .content-message-c2ecb54d47d2482721d5173f8d0ef474 .reservationType-988f9da053526ce16e9af077e255896b .right-type{-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-flex-direction:column;-ms-flex-direction:column;flex-direction:column;-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1;padding-left:.266667rem;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;justify-content:space-between}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56 .content-message-c2ecb54d47d2482721d5173f8d0ef474 .reservationType-988f9da053526ce16e9af077e255896b .group-type{background:#6580b4;height:48%;border-radius:.133333rem}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56 .content-message-c2ecb54d47d2482721d5173f8d0ef474 .reservationType-988f9da053526ce16e9af077e255896b .research-activities{background-color:#79608b;height:48%;border-radius:.133333rem}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56 .content-message-c2ecb54d47d2482721d5173f8d0ef474 .reservation-inquiry{margin-top:.266667rem;background:-webkit-gradient(linear,left top,left bottom,from(#66a6ff),to(#7266ff));background:-webkit-linear-gradient(top,#66a6ff,#7266ff);background:linear-gradient(180deg,#66a6ff,#7266ff);height:2.133333rem;width:100%;color:#fff;border-radius:.133333rem}.select-reservation-type-2efdde5511254d91e5efb30d6b05db56 .content-message-c2ecb54d47d2482721d5173f8d0ef474 .individual-text{padding:.4rem .4rem;font-size:.48rem;font-weight:600;color:#fff}.visitor-instructions-page-cb3157236c9bf4406c984cd51c6c85cd{height:100%;width:100%;background-color:#eef8fe}.visitor-instructions-page-cb3157236c9bf4406c984cd51c6c85cd .content-message{padding:.533333rem}.visitor-instructions-page-cb3157236c9bf4406c984cd51c6c85cd .content-message .title{color:#66affc;font-size:.533333rem;font-weight:600;line-height:.8rem}.visitor-instructions-page-cb3157236c9bf4406c984cd51c6c85cd .content-message .sub-title{font-size:.426667rem;font-weight:600;padding:.266667rem 0;margin-top:.533333rem}.visitor-instructions-page-cb3157236c9bf4406c984cd51c6c85cd .content-message .red{color:red}.visitor-instructions-page-cb3157236c9bf4406c984cd51c6c85cd .content-message .paragraph{line-height:.666667rem;font-size:.373333rem}.logo-e2efcdbc7271348eb27ea85e58435a04{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center}.logo-e2efcdbc7271348eb27ea85e58435a04 img{width:80%}.pt-reservation-form-0ae1e9ba9c82b89ea1af116e5e45bfe8 .submit-button{background:-webkit-gradient(linear,left top,left bottom,from(#66a6ff),to(#7266ff));background:-webkit-linear-gradient(top,#66a6ff,#7266ff);background:linear-gradient(180deg,#66a6ff,#7266ff)}.pt-reservation-form-0ae1e9ba9c82b89ea1af116e5e45bfe8 .reservation-item-title{font-size:.4rem;color:#000;margin-bottom:.4rem}.pt-sign-form__page{height:100%}